Trans-Spinal Direct Current Stimulation for Managing Primary Orthostatic Tremor
Jean-Charles Lamy1, Pasquale Varriale1, Emmanuelle Apartis1,2
1Institut du Cerveau / Paris Brain Institute, ICM, Hôpital de la Pitié-Salpêtrière, CNRS UMR 7225, Inserm U 1127, Sorbonne Université UM75, Paris, France.
Trans-spinal direct current stimulation (tsDCS) offers a promising non-invasive treatment for primary orthostatic tremor (POT). A single session improved standing time and reduced tremor, suggesting potential for future therapeutic applications.

Background:
- Primary orthostatic tremor (POT) is a rare, often treatment-refractory condition causing leg tremors when standing.
- Current treatments like epidural spinal cord stimulation are invasive, limiting their use.
Purpose of the Study:
- To investigate the efficacy of trans-spinal direct current stimulation (tsDCS) as a non-invasive treatment for POT.
- To assess the effects of tsDCS on tremor, standing ability, and corticospinal excitability in POT patients.
Main Methods:
- A double-blind, sham-controlled study involving 16 POT patients.
- Patients received either sham or active tsDCS (cathodal or anodal) in separate sessions.
- Outcomes included time in standing, tremor quantification, corticospinal excitability, and clinical improvement scores.
Main Results:
- Cathodal tsDCS significantly reduced tremor amplitude, frequency, and corticospinal excitability.
- Anodal tsDCS primarily reduced tremor frequency.
- Clinical improvement scores correlated positively with increased standing time after both active tsDCS conditions.
Conclusions:
- A single tsDCS session can improve postural instability in POT patients.
- This non-invasive neuromodulation technique presents a novel therapeutic avenue for POT.
- Further research into multiple tsDCS sessions is warranted for POT management.
